"Boyfriend on Demand is a lighthearted Netflix K-drama rom-com centered on a webtoon producer who uses a virtual AI boyfriend service to escape real-life dating frustrations, ultimately embracing authentic romance with a colleague.
The show sticks to traditional rom-com territory, emphasizing personal growth through virtual vs. real love amid incidental themes like workplace burnout and tech escapism, without delving into progressive activism, políticas identitarias, or critiques of systemic issues. Featuring an all-Korean cast with no DEI-driven changes or forced diversity, it garners positive reception as fluffy, relatable entertainment free from heavy-handed messaging, aligning with its overall woke score of 2/10."
